Materna, the German prima donna, who never forgets America, where she wade her fortune, keeps a large album containing photographs of all the celebrated places which she saw in America; and she constantly entertains her guests with stories of this wonderful country. James R. Randall, the Southern poet who wrote the striking war lyric, "Maryland, My Maryland," turns out to have been inspired by Cupid no less than Mars. He loved one of the beauties, for whom Baltimore is famous. In beating cake beat from the bottom of the mixing bowl with a wooden spoon, bringing it up full and high ' with each stroke, and as soon as the in-' gredients are fairly and smoothly mixed stop beating, or your cake will be ought. Josssa Budget. Buttermilk Muffins These have but to be tried to become a standing breakfast dish. Boat hard two eggs Into a quart of buttermilk; stir ia flour to make thick batter about a quart and lastly a teaspuonful of salt and the same of soda. Bake in a hot oven in well-greaeed. tins. Muffins of all kinds should only be cut just around the edge, then pulled open with the fingers. Guod Ilouckrtping. Nowadays it is almost imItostfible to tell the difference between the rigs of the merchautiki captain, the dockmaster, the oustoms man and the harbormaster. But what do you say to a blue coat, bkek velvet lajwls cuffs ami collars with a bright gold embroidery, waistcoat and breeches of deep buff, the buttoas of yellow gilt, cocked hnt, shle arms, and so forth?
